Melanya is a girl's name of Greek origin. A Slavic or Eastern European variant of Melanie, Melanya uses the -ya ending common in Russian, Ukrainian, and Polish naming traditions. It bridges Greek etymological roots with Eastern European linguistic patterns, creating international sophistication. Melanya appeals to families with dual cultural backgrounds.
Shows Eastern European linguistic influence; the -ya ending is characteristic of Slavic languages.
